وَسَبِّحُوهُ بُكْرَةً وَأَصِيلًا ("And proclaim His purity at morn and eve". 33:42) Here morning and evening may, metaphorically, mean all the time. Alternatively, morning and evening have been mentioned specifically to lay emphasis on carrying out dhikrullah during these times and to indicate that it carries more blessings - otherwise dhikrullah is neither specified nor limited to any particular time.
